USING THE HEATED ARM
FORMS
(SEE DRAWINGS PAGE 10-2)
Proceed in the following way:
a) For heated forms turn on the switch "POS.
85" and wait for some minutes before to use
it, to allow it to heat. A thermostat inside the
form controls the heating temperature.
b) Rotate the arm form that you want to use by
placing it in the work position.
SPOTTING DEVICE
(SEE DRAWINGS PAGE 10-2)
Proceed as follows:
a) Open the globe valve fitted on the external
compressor thus allowing air to flow from
the compressor to the apparatus.
b) Fill up with clear water the small tank "POS.
99".
c) For spotting operations use the proper
spotting arm; the arm in rest position is not
connected to the vacuum, the connection is
made by swinging the arm and putting it in
working position.

a) The spotting guns must be used very close
to the cloth (at about ½ cm) to get the
maximum penetration of water/air mixture
into the fibre at a pressure of 8-10bar (116-
145 psi); this action should remove any
foreign matter from the cloth.

e) The drying air gun should always be
brought into contact with the cloth to allow
the maximum penetration of air without
losses.
f)
For grease spots the solvent spray gun
should be used as indicated above, but
using the gun with solvent.

a) A few minutes before stopping work, turn off
the boiler by "POS. 57"
working until the steam is finished.
b) Turn off the main isolator switch.
c) Turn off the gate valve of the main water
supply.
d) When the boiler pressure has dropped
below approximately 1 bar (approximately
15 psi), open the discharge gate valve
"POS. 17", empty the boiler and then close
the gate valve. Turn the boiler on again,
run in fresh water. As soon as the pump has
stopped, turn the boiler off without draining it.
